2359 Commits

Author SHA1 Message Date
neil%parkwaycc.co.uk
ae8e1ed1de Bug 384874 Fix regression from previous patch for bug 382746 r=Enn sr=bz
git-svn-id: svn://10.0.0.236/trunk@228423 18797224-902f-48f8-a5cc-f745e15eee43
2007-06-21 10:25:07 +00:00
Olli.Pettay%helsinki.fi
fb65e34019 Bug 384491, remove assertion when <xul:listboxbody style='overflow: hidden' />, r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@228421 18797224-902f-48f8-a5cc-f745e15eee43
2007-06-21 09:35:41 +00:00
dbaron%dbaron.org
5d738bf573 Back out patch to make mousethrough attribute apply to all elements. b=380094 a=roc
git-svn-id: svn://10.0.0.236/trunk@228273 18797224-902f-48f8-a5cc-f745e15eee43
2007-06-18 23:22:46 +00:00
Olli.Pettay%helsinki.fi
85080fe2c2 Bug 383837, Crash [@ nsXULTooltipListener::LaunchTooltip], r=enn, sr=neil
git-svn-id: svn://10.0.0.236/trunk@228132 18797224-902f-48f8-a5cc-f745e15eee43
2007-06-15 18:53:42 +00:00
Olli.Pettay%helsinki.fi
8dab978b21 Bug 382444, r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@228040 18797224-902f-48f8-a5cc-f745e15eee43
2007-06-14 08:37:22 +00:00
Olli.Pettay%helsinki.fi
6ca375d76a Adding a null check, Bug 384133, r=enn, sr=neil
git-svn-id: svn://10.0.0.236/trunk@228038 18797224-902f-48f8-a5cc-f745e15eee43
2007-06-14 08:18:11 +00:00
Olli.Pettay%helsinki.fi
7c6404ecba Bug 381120, ensure view in reflowcallback, r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@227852 18797224-902f-48f8-a5cc-f745e15eee43
2007-06-12 10:26:13 +00:00
neil%parkwaycc.co.uk
757c52cf6e Bug 383236 Fix missing null-check from previous patch for bug 382746 r=Enn sr=bz
git-svn-id: svn://10.0.0.236/trunk@227606 18797224-902f-48f8-a5cc-f745e15eee43
2007-06-06 20:28:47 +00:00
neil%parkwaycc.co.uk
38b217e46f Bug 382746 "ASSERTION: Lists not the same length"
Bug 382899 "ASSERTION: bad pref, min, max size"
Both patches r=Enn sr=bz


git-svn-id: svn://10.0.0.236/trunk@227436 18797224-902f-48f8-a5cc-f745e15eee43
2007-06-03 20:46:59 +00:00
enndeakin%sympatico.ca
1ed2e845f3 Bug 332283, drop indicator not working for trees, r=sr=roc
git-svn-id: svn://10.0.0.236/trunk@227298 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-30 23:09:56 +00:00
Olli.Pettay%helsinki.fi
28d7f8000d Bug 381862, r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@227005 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-25 10:14:55 +00:00
Olli.Pettay%helsinki.fi
6b55e07406 Bug 381153, r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@227004 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-25 10:09:29 +00:00
masayuki%d-toybox.com
9679aade82 Bug 381426 Can't be activated Input Method in the Bookmark Properties. #2 r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@226941 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-24 06:51:42 +00:00
sharparrow1%yahoo.com
7645b7424a Bug 381645: Remove nsBoxFrame::GetContentOf. r+sr=dbaron.
git-svn-id: svn://10.0.0.236/trunk@226846 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-23 03:48:43 +00:00
sharparrow1%yahoo.com
d387c5a846 Bug 381621: Get rid of nsBoxFrame::AddRef/Release, plus a few misc cleanups. r+sr=dbaron.
git-svn-id: svn://10.0.0.236/trunk@226807 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-22 20:34:00 +00:00
masayuki%d-toybox.com
88b19fbea4 Bug 381426 Can't be activated Input Method in the Bookmark Properties. r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@226757 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-21 22:58:17 +00:00
Olli.Pettay%helsinki.fi
c6473e3758 Bug 378961, r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@226702 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-21 07:33:32 +00:00
Olli.Pettay%helsinki.fi
bec84f1922 Bug 381167, r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@226701 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-21 07:27:47 +00:00
Olli.Pettay%helsinki.fi
c07b945efb Bug 380217, r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@226614 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-18 11:37:57 +00:00
neil%parkwaycc.co.uk
689538e23a Relanding bug 377035 Allow tree as anonymous parent of treechildren r=Enn sr=roc
git-svn-id: svn://10.0.0.236/trunk@226584 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-17 20:55:03 +00:00
bzbarsky%mit.edu
3d66fb663f Make sure FrameNeedsReflow() is not called during reflow, and remove the
wasDirty asserts and O(N^2) check for existing reflow root in the list.  Bug
379904, r=roc, sr=dbaron


git-svn-id: svn://10.0.0.236/trunk@226500 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-16 03:22:45 +00:00
ginn.chen%sun.com
cd223a580b Bug 357969 container xul element which doesn't have a xbl def under a deck frame has no accessible object
patch by nian.liu at sun.com r=surkov.alexander sr=neil


git-svn-id: svn://10.0.0.236/trunk@226458 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-15 09:46:08 +00:00
Olli.Pettay%helsinki.fi
7a1f7182a1 Bug 363089, Remove nsIDOMEventReceiver (this time passes mochitest), r+sr=jst
git-svn-id: svn://10.0.0.236/trunk@226373 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-14 09:13:09 +00:00
mats.palmgren%bredband.net
db90382f98 Don't create a widget if the view already has one and check error return code from CreateViewForFrame(). b=374102 r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@226364 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-14 00:42:39 +00:00
asqueella%gmail.com
3ec52d9b96 Bug 380094 - make mousethrough more generally useful
p=toshok@hungry.com
r+sr=roc


git-svn-id: svn://10.0.0.236/trunk@226352 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-13 16:00:00 +00:00
Olli.Pettay%helsinki.fi
74bedad7b0 backout Bug 363089
git-svn-id: svn://10.0.0.236/trunk@226300 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-11 13:34:12 +00:00
Olli.Pettay%helsinki.fi
174896a945 Bug 363089, Remove nsIDOMEventReceiver, r+sr=jst
git-svn-id: svn://10.0.0.236/trunk@226293 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-11 11:15:20 +00:00
neil%parkwaycc.co.uk
2671ffbdb4 Bug 375403 originally started off as a simple request to enable window translucency when windows or popups use opacity, alpha transparent background or non-zero border radius but mutated to include refactoring non zero side testing r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@226257 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-10 15:46:42 +00:00
neil%parkwaycc.co.uk
7e886e1d93 Backing out bug 377035 because it caches the tree body inappropriately
git-svn-id: svn://10.0.0.236/trunk@226206 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-09 20:13:26 +00:00
neil%parkwaycc.co.uk
5bb6cedddf Bug 377035 Allow <tree> to be anonymous parent of <treechildren> r=Enn sr=roc
git-svn-id: svn://10.0.0.236/trunk@226179 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-09 08:54:24 +00:00
neil%parkwaycc.co.uk
c72cb13cb8 Bug 281630 Support ch width units in XUL r+sr=bz
git-svn-id: svn://10.0.0.236/trunk@226178 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-09 08:48:38 +00:00
bzbarsky%mit.edu
ba5badedcb Change the FrameNeedsReflow API to pass the dirty flags to be added directly to
the method, instead of setting them before calling the method.  That way we can
avoid reflowing the ancestor of a reflow root which is not itself dirty but has
dirty children.  This also makes it harder to set dirty bits inconsistently
with the FrameNeedsReflow call.  Bug 378784, r+sr=dbaron, pending rbs' review
on the mathml parts.


git-svn-id: svn://10.0.0.236/trunk@226007 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-06 19:16:52 +00:00
dbaron%dbaron.org
03a83ad9f2 Add support for -moz-intrinsic, -moz-min-intrinsic, -moz-shrink-wrap, and -moz-fill for width, min-width, and max-width. b=311415 r+sr=bzbarsky
git-svn-id: svn://10.0.0.236/trunk@225554 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-03 23:11:02 +00:00
joshmoz%gmail.com
002eb7e32d Remove some files as part of bug 379319. r=enn sr=dbaron
git-svn-id: svn://10.0.0.236/trunk@225470 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-02 18:13:18 +00:00
masayuki%d-toybox.com
345d3747bf Bug 378752 Mnemonic of Menu doesn't work if an editor has focus and IME is on r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@225454 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-02 15:34:36 +00:00
joshmoz%gmail.com
0bfd5f5156 Remove nsINativeScrollbar and nsNativeScrollbarFrame. patch by Colin Barrett. b=379319 r=enn sr=dbaron
git-svn-id: svn://10.0.0.236/trunk@225436 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-02 07:46:50 +00:00
bzbarsky%mit.edu
d2d337437c Introduce a GetPrimaryShell() API on nsIDocument. Convert existing callers of
GetShellAt(0) to using this API.  Bug 378780.  API introduction part by me,
r+sr=jst.  Mass-changes done by taras using squash, r+sr=me


git-svn-id: svn://10.0.0.236/trunk@225416 18797224-902f-48f8-a5cc-f745e15eee43
2007-05-01 22:24:25 +00:00
bzbarsky%mit.edu
a794c3824d Fix bug 379229, r+sr=dbaron
git-svn-id: svn://10.0.0.236/trunk@225246 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-30 06:17:03 +00:00
mats.palmgren%bredband.net
a7a5cf0e26 Create a rendering context before calling GetPrefSize and friends and assert in those methods that we have one. b=379090 r+sr=dbaron
git-svn-id: svn://10.0.0.236/trunk@225237 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-29 22:24:59 +00:00
Olli.Pettay%helsinki.fi
8590551f25 Bug 377899, Cycle between nsXULTooltipListener and nsGlobalWindows causes leaks, r=neil,sr=peterv
git-svn-id: svn://10.0.0.236/trunk@225016 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-25 17:18:50 +00:00
longsonr%gmail.com
086a2439bc Bug 377833 - Crash on SVG element nested in a xul:stack. r+sr=bzbarsky
git-svn-id: svn://10.0.0.236/trunk@224931 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-24 08:14:58 +00:00
benjamin%smedbergs.us
7262cdad6d Bug 376636 - Building with gcc 4.3 and -pendatic fails due to extra semicolons, patch by Art Haas <ahaas@airmail.net>, rs=me
git-svn-id: svn://10.0.0.236/trunk@224885 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-23 14:22:04 +00:00
enndeakin%sympatico.ca
1f82e44d11 Bug 374570, constrain popups to frame, r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@224799 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-20 18:20:04 +00:00
enndeakin%sympatico.ca
c05c103c18 Bug 377663, <titlebar> should move popup if inside one instead of the window, r+sr=roc
git-svn-id: svn://10.0.0.236/trunk@224785 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-20 10:56:49 +00:00
jst%mozilla.org
0375e75c1f Fixing bug 377449. Remove unnecessary arguments from LaunchTooltip(). r+sr=neil@parkwaycc.co.uk
git-svn-id: svn://10.0.0.236/trunk@224595 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-16 23:22:34 +00:00
neil%parkwaycc.co.uk
faeb0b0eaf Fix tooltip crash (regression from bug 376802) b=377473 r+sr=jst
git-svn-id: svn://10.0.0.236/trunk@224542 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-15 11:25:53 +00:00
neil%parkwaycc.co.uk
5a05cc5e8e Bug 377035 Allow <tree> to be anonymous parent of <treechildren> r=Enn sr=roc
git-svn-id: svn://10.0.0.236/trunk@224468 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-12 21:18:47 +00:00
neil%parkwaycc.co.uk
d0f0d0d1d5 Bug 376802 Use one global tooltip listener instead of creating one for each XUL element that needs one r=Smaug sr=jst
git-svn-id: svn://10.0.0.236/trunk@224465 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-12 20:59:01 +00:00
mozilla.mano%sent.com
524d38f060 Bug 377181 - 'Jump to here' system preference is not followed by (new) non-native scrollbars. r-cbarrett, sr=roc.
git-svn-id: svn://10.0.0.236/trunk@224424 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-12 00:36:41 +00:00
joshmoz%gmail.com
d5e3fc289e Draw native scrollbars using nsITheme on Mac OS X. Don't use a cocoa control. Fixes a whole host of clipping and visibility bugs and bugs 339447, 369293, 370439. r=josh sr=roc
git-svn-id: svn://10.0.0.236/trunk@224386 18797224-902f-48f8-a5cc-f745e15eee43
2007-04-11 00:25:11 +00:00